Overheard at a café. and no, i can’t forget it.
id: 10053148

— …and you think she’s waiting for you?
— I don’t know. I hope so. I just… want to be waited for somewhere.

— Did you tell her that?
— I’d rather say, “Forget me.”
— Why?
— Because I don’t want to be another pain in her life.

— Are you sure you’re pain, not a chance?
(silence)
— No. I’m not sure of anything when I look in her eyes. It’s all too real. And that’s scary.



I was sitting there, holding a cup of coffee.
Pretending to read.
But my hands were shaking from what I heard.

How often do we stay silent when we should speak?
Hide when we want to come closer?
Push someone away when we’re really saying, “Please, stay”?

I don’t know how their conversation ended.
But I do know — we’ve all had those moments.
When someone was too scared to love us.
And we were too scared to show we already do.
